Autor | Zpráva | ||
---|---|---|---|
D15 Profil * |
#1 · Zasláno: 19. 2. 2007, 23:39:48
Prosím, jak můžu při odesílání formuláře spustit dvě funkce tak, aby se provedla první, počkalo se třeba 10 sekund a pak se teprve zkontroloval obsah formuláře?
Zatím to dělám takto (špatná varianta): form ... onSubmit="xajax_zjisti(document.getElementById('usr').value);return verify_form()" Vím, že to, co chci, je nedokonalé (odezva ze serveru nemusí přijít do 10 s). Případně jak mohu provádět nějakou javascript funkci vždy při změně obsahu input type text políčka? Zkoušel jsem onKeyPress - ale to jsem zase do toho políčka nemohl psát. Díky za odpovědi, JS moc neholduju:-) |
||
D15 Profil * |
#2 · Zasláno: 20. 2. 2007, 00:18:09
Již jsem zjistil první část - můžu použít onBlur nebo onKeyUp ...
|
||
peta Profil |
#3 · Zasláno: 20. 2. 2007, 07:27:24
1)
onsubmit="funkce1();funkce2();funkce3();" jakpsatweb - javascript - priklady - datum a cas 2) onchange/onkeyup/onkeypress (u onkeypress musi byt navratova funkce return true) 3) jak provadet script pri zmene obsahu iframe function funkce1() {} function funkce2() {} var x=funkce1; window.jmenoramu.src="..."; v ramu mas bud dole pod body SCRIPT parent.x(document) nebo myslim i jako BODY onload=parent.x(document) by to mohlo fungovat Pro funkci2: var x=funkce1; window.jmenoramu.src="..."; (v ramu mas totez X, takze 100% nahrazka ajaxu s requestem) |
||
Časová prodleva: 17 let
|
Toto téma je uzamčeno. Odpověď nelze zaslat.
0